Posts - Bill - SRES 454 A resolution expressing support for the designation of the week of October 24, 2025, to October 31, 2025, as "Bat Week".
senate 10/16/2025 - 119th Congress
We are supporting the designation of the week of October 24-31, 2025, as Bat Week to raise awareness about the vital role bats play in ecosystems and agriculture. Through this recognition, we aim to promote conservation efforts and combat the devastating white-nose syndrome affecting bat populations.
